How to Tell the Difference: Anxiety vs. Panic Attacks

Anxiety and panic attacks can feel similar, but they’re not the same. Anxiety is often a low-level, ongoing worry, while panic attacks come on suddenly and intensely, with physical symptoms like racing heart, shortness of breath, or dizziness. Recognizing the difference can help you respond with the right coping strategies.

FAQ: Why Do Some People Feel Depressed Even When Life Looks “Fine”?

Depression doesn’t depend on external success. Brain chemistry, trauma, stress, and emotional suppression can all contribute, even when everything appears okay on the surface. Understanding this helps reduce stigma and encourages compassion, for yourself and others.

Why Rest Is Essential

Sleep affects how we think, feel, and respond to daily challenges. Prioritizing rest can improve focus, emotional stability, and overall mental health. Try to create a consistent sleep schedule and a calming bedtime routine.

Signs You Might Benefit from DBT

Dialectical Behavior Therapy (DBT) can help with emotional regulation, relationship challenges, or self-destructive behaviors. You might benefit if you struggle with intense emotions, impulsivity, or feeling misunderstood. Seeking guidance is a strong first step.
